Digital technologies : Rolls-Royce in Dahlewitz on KI

The British Rolls-Royce group sees itself as the industry pioneer in the digitization. Regardless of the Brexit to build now in Brandenburg, Dahlewitz, the first center for Artificial intelligence. Thus, the largest German location of the company is upgraded again. Overall, Rolls-Royce wants to invest in the next five years, with a total of 100 million pounds in Artificial intelligence and new data technologies.

The relatively humble beginning, to make a handful of specialists. Their Bodies have already been put out to tender in the coming year, the work in Dahlewitz to start. You will work closely with academic institutions from the Region and from the Start-up scenes in Brandenburg, Germany and especially in Berlin benefit. With the Hasso-Plattner-Institute has already agreed to a cooperation.

But that's not enough Starting next year, cameras are used, the was compare all of the approximately 10 000 parts of a finished engine with its digital twin and recognize when something is missing or incorrectly mounted. And inspections of the drives, in the future, be much more frequent, without time-consuming disassembly of the aircraft. Because flexible endoscopes are not able in all parts of the engine inside advance, will in future have to crawl tiny, beetle-like robots in the most inaccessible parts, and from there send recordings, which are assembled by the engineers to an overall picture. Around five inches large prototypes were already developed. In five to ten years, they are reduced to a few millimeters and ready for deployment.
